Norris Industries (NRIS) Retained Earnings (2016 - 2025)
Norris Industries' Retained Earnings history spans 11 years, with the latest figure at -$12.2 million for Q3 2025.
- For Q3 2025, Retained Earnings fell 5.12% year-over-year to -$12.2 million; the TTM value through Aug 2025 reached -$12.2 million, down 5.12%, while the annual FY2025 figure was -$11.9 million, 4.96% down from the prior year.
- Retained Earnings reached -$12.2 million in Q3 2025 per NRIS's latest filing, down from -$12.0 million in the prior quarter.
- In the past five years, Retained Earnings ranged from a high of -$9.7 million in Q1 2021 to a low of -$12.2 million in Q3 2025.
- Average Retained Earnings over 5 years is -$10.9 million, with a median of -$10.9 million recorded in 2023.
- Peak YoY movement for Retained Earnings: decreased 12.97% in 2021, then fell 3.04% in 2022.
- A 5-year view of Retained Earnings shows it stood at -$10.1 million in 2021, then fell by 3.04% to -$10.5 million in 2022, then fell by 6.33% to -$11.1 million in 2023, then decreased by 5.74% to -$11.8 million in 2024, then fell by 3.72% to -$12.2 million in 2025.
